#d9b5b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9b5bb is composed of 85.1% red, 71%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.6%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 350 degrees, a saturation of 32.1% and a lightness of 78%. #d9b5b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b36b77.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d9b5bb color description : Light grayish red.
#d9b5b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9b5bb has RGB values of R:217, G:181,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.14,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14267835.

Shades and Tints of #d9b5b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#faf6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9b5bb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8c6c6 is the less saturated color, while #fb93a4 is the most saturated one.
